How to fill out the MN DoR M1 online

Filling out the MN DoR M1 form online can streamline your tax declaration process and ensure accuracy. This guide provides step-by-step instructions to help you navigate each section of the form with confidence.

Follow the steps to successfully complete your MN DoR M1 online form.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access the MN DoR M1 form and open it in your browser.
  2. In the first section, indicate whether you have a foreign address by placing an X in the provided box. If you are filing a joint return, enter your spouse's first name, middle initial, last name, and their Social Security number.
  3. Fill in your current home address (street, apartment number, and route), along with your date of birth and your spouse's date of birth.
  4. Select your federal filing status by placing an X in the appropriate box: single, married filing jointly, married filing separately, head of household, or qualifying widow(er).
  5. If applicable, enter the code number of your preferred political party for the State Elections Campaign Fund. This donation will not affect your tax liability.
  6. Complete the income section by entering your federal taxable income, any applicable state tax additions, and other income adjustments as directed. Make sure to reference the specific lines from corresponding federal forms.
  7. Calculate your Minnesota taxable income by subtracting total subtractions from your total income. If the result is zero or less, leave that field blank as instructed.
  8. Determine your tax using the provided tax tables and complete the alternatives such as the tax before credits and any required schedules.
  9. Fill in the section for nonrefundable credits, including any credits for taxes paid to another state or other applicable credits as indicated.
  10. Add any payments made, including Minnesota income tax withheld and credits. Complete all relevant lines to ensure accurate reporting of your total payments.
  11. Calculate your refund or the amount you owe. If applicable, complete the direct deposit information for your refund. Make sure to write checks payable to Minnesota Revenue if you owe.
  12. Review all entries for accuracy before signing and dating the form. Include your federal return and any required schedules as instructed.
  13. Save your changes to the online form. You can then download, print, or share the completed M1 form as needed for your records.

When submitting your tax return, including the MN DoR M1, you should avoid stapling or paper-clipping your documents. Instead, place your forms in a flat envelope without any fasteners to ensure easy processing. This helps the tax department handle your submission more efficiently. Remember, it’s important to keep everything organized for your records.

Generally, there is no penalty for simply filing an amended tax return using the MN DoR M1 form. However, if you owe additional taxes as a result of the amendments, you may be subject to interest charges. It's crucial to file amendments as soon as you spot errors to minimize any potential issues. If you're unsure, consulting a tax professional can clarify specific situations.

Nonresidents who receive income from Minnesota sources must file a Minnesota nonresident tax return. This obligation includes income from jobs, businesses, or investments located in Minnesota. You can simplify this process by using the MN DoR M1 form, which is specifically designed for these tax situations.
